Today we were in worship - doing the Words from the cross...it's solemn and somber - there is the hint of incense - the altar is bare - and there is a grandmother and 7 grandkids sitting behind me. She has brought them every day to worship. My guess is they are out of school and staying with their gram during the day because they come to worship and then go on a little field trip. One day it was the movies another it was bowling. I didnt hear where they were going today. First - I LOVE that she brings them to worship. Kids learn so much simply by "showing up" and watching what is going on. But even more - I loved during what almost seems like a funeral mass there are kids playing tic tac toe and giggling. They weren't being disrespectful at all - they were being kids who were sitting in church during what can seem endless! At the end of the service the chimes ring 33 times and they were trying to figure out what was going on - one said it must be 12:00. Another said no we got here at 12:00 it must be an alarm clock. hah. it was cute. then the older brother leaned over and said no its ringing 33 times - Jesus was 33 years old when he died. oooh they said - that's why people were crying - jesus died on the cross. Interesting to me that the pieces all came together all over again for them in a new way.
